Organizational Context
The International Organization for Migration (IOM), a UN-related organization, is dedicated to humane and orderly migration benefiting migrants and society. It provides advice on migration policy and practice, supports migrants globally, and builds capacity for governments to manage mobility. IOM upholds human rights and the dignity of migrants. The "Labour Migration Programme - Central Asia" and the "Mobility Tracking Matrix (MTM) Regional Evidence for Migration Analysis and Policy (REMAP)" projects aim to enhance migration governance, protect migrant workers, and contribute to evidence-based programming in the region.
Job Purpose
This UN Volunteer assignment supports the IOM's "Labour Migration Programme - Central Asia" and the "MTM REMAP" project. The primary purpose is to collect and analyze data on human mobility and displacement within Kazakhstan and surrounding countries. The role involves conducting individual interviews with migrants, ensuring data confidentiality and accuracy, and contributing to evidence-based humanitarian and development programming. The volunteer will play a crucial role in understanding migration dynamics, enhancing labor migration governance, and ensuring the protection of migrant workers, ultimately contributing to better policy and practice in the region.
Responsibilities
The UN Volunteer will conduct individual face-to-face interviews with migrants, ensuring data accuracy and completeness. This includes conducting follow-up interviews, making necessary observations, and obtaining written consent for photos. A key task is developing at least one compelling migrant story and submitting a narrative report post-data collection. The volunteer must strictly adhere to IOM guidelines and the code of conduct, ensuring confidentiality, security of data, and respecting the privacy and rights of individuals surveyed. Participation in training is mandatory to understand methodologies and IOM principles. Additionally, the role involves developing fieldwork plans, coordinating daily schedules with supervisors, preparing necessary equipment, establishing positive relationships with community focal points, documenting field challenges, and submitting completed survey forms via KOBO, ensuring correct data upload.
